前端vue框架是什么意思
-
前端vue框架是指Vue.js,它是一个用于构建用户界面的开源JavaScript框架。Vue.js是由尤雨溪在2014年创建的,目前由一个活跃的开源社区维护和发展。
Vue.js的主要特点有以下几点:
-
简洁易学:Vue.js使用简单的API和模板语法,容易学习和上手,使得开发者能够快速构建用户界面。
-
组件化开发:Vue.js将页面拆分为多个组件,提供了方便的组件化开发方式。每个组件可以拥有自己的状态和逻辑,组件之间可以互相通信和组合,使得代码更加可维护和可复用。
-
响应式数据绑定:Vue.js使用了响应式的数据绑定机制,当数据发生变化时,页面会自动更新。这个特性可以极大提高开发效率,同时也使得用户能够获得更加流畅的交互体验。
-
虚拟DOM:Vue.js使用虚拟DOM来优化页面渲染性能。在数据变化时,Vue.js会通过比对虚拟DOM的差异来最小化DOM操作,从而提高页面渲染的效率。
除了以上特点,Vue.js还拥有丰富的生态系统和社区支持。它与各种工具和库(如vue-router、Vuex等)可以很好地配合使用,满足不同项目的需求。
总结来说,前端vue框架(Vue.js)是一个灵活、高效并且易于使用的JavaScript框架,它能够帮助开发者构建优秀的用户界面。
1年前 -
-
前端vue框架指的是一种开源的JavaScript框架,用于构建用户界面。它由尤雨溪开发,并于2014年首次发布。Vue框架的目标是通过简单易用的API,提供高效、灵活和可扩展的前端开发解决方案。
下面是关于前端Vue框架的几个要点:
-
组件化开发:Vue框架采用组件化开发的方式,将页面拆分成多个独立的组件,每个组件负责自己的功能和样式,通过组合不同的组件来构建复杂的页面。这种组件化的开发方式使得代码具有更好的可维护性和复用性。
-
响应式数据绑定:Vue框架提供了一种方便的方式来处理数据的变化和更新,称为响应式数据绑定。通过将数据与页面元素绑定,在数据发生变化时,页面自动更新相应的内容。这种方式减少了手动更新DOM的工作量,并提高了开发效率。
-
虚拟DOM:Vue框架采用虚拟DOM技术来提高页面渲染性能。虚拟DOM是在内存中维护一份与实际DOM结构相对应的虚拟树,通过比较前后两次虚拟DOM的差异,减少对实际DOM的操作次数,从而提高页面的渲染效率。
-
插件系统:Vue框架支持使用插件来扩展其功能。开发者可以根据需要选择合适的插件,用于增加一些特定的功能或解决特定的问题。Vue社区中有很多开源的插件可以使用,如路由管理、状态管理、表单验证等。
-
生态系统:Vue框架拥有一个庞大而活跃的生态系统,有大量的第三方库、工具和组件可供选择和使用。这些资源丰富了开发者的工具箱,可以提高开发效率和质量。同时,Vue社区也非常活跃,开发者可以在社区中获取到大量的学习资料、教程和解决方案。
总之,前端Vue框架是一款功能强大且易于使用的JavaScript框架,可以帮助开发者快速构建交互性强、响应式的前端应用程序。它的组件化开发、响应式数据绑定、虚拟DOM等特性使得前端开发更加高效和灵活。并且,Vue拥有丰富的插件和活跃的社区,为开发者提供了很多便利和资源支持。
1年前 -
-
前端Vue框架是一种用于构建用户界面的开源JavaScript框架。它采用了MVVM(模型-视图-视图模型)的架构模式,使开发者能够通过简单的语法和数据绑定实现高效的用户界面开发。
Vue框架的特点如下:
-
轻量级:Vue的核心库只有20KB大小,因此加载速度快,并且在性能方面表现出色。
-
响应式:Vue使用双向绑定的数据流,当数据发生改变时,自动更新对应的视图。这大大减少了开发者手动操作DOM的工作量。
-
组件化:Vue将界面划分为独立的、可重用的组件,每个组件都有自己的模板、样式和逻辑。这样可以提高代码的可维护性和复用性。
-
易学易用:Vue的语法简洁明了,学习曲线较低。同时,它也提供了丰富的官方文档和社区资源,方便开发者进行学习和交流。
使用Vue框架进行前端开发的流程如下:
-
安装Vue:首先,需要在项目中安装Vue.js,可以通过CDN引入Vue.js文件,也可以使用npm或yarn安装Vue.js的包。
-
创建Vue实例:在页面中引入Vue.js后,需要创建一个Vue实例来管理整个应用程序。在创建Vue实例时,可以指定一些选项,如el(绑定到页面的元素)、data(数据对象)和methods(事件处理方法)等。
-
定义模板:Vue使用模板语法来定义页面的结构和动态内容。模板中可以使用Vue提供的指令和插值语法,来实现数据绑定和事件监听。
-
组件化开发:根据需求,将页面划分为独立的组件,每个组件都有自己的模板、样式和逻辑。可以使用Vue组件选项来创建组件,并在父组件中引用和使用子组件。
-
数据绑定:Vue提供了丰富的数据绑定方式,包括文本绑定、属性绑定、样式绑定和类绑定等。可以通过v-bind指令将属性和样式绑定到Vue实例中的数据上。
-
事件处理:Vue提供了v-on指令来监听DOM事件,并触发对应的方法。可以在方法中修改数据或执行其他操作。
-
生命周期:Vue组件有自己的生命周期钩子函数,可以在不同的阶段执行对应的操作。可以利用这些钩子函数来处理组件的初始化、数据更新和销毁等情况。
-
构建和部署:最后,可以使用Vue的命令行工具进行代码的打包和压缩,生成用于生产环境的文件。然后,将打包后的文件部署到服务器上。
总结来说,Vue框架是一种用于构建前端用户界面的JavaScript框架。通过Vue的数据绑定和组件化特性,开发者可以更高效地开发出功能强大、用户友好的Web应用。
1年前 -